Output 687191a90bbce494e3102cc17a7209615989b84c748a22efeb9090690e4cc4f5:1

value
1066661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89ec5a472b397e441f10ecfc5c98e801c414891c OP_EQUALVERIFY OP_CHECKSIG
address
1DaGiMLgtNnP8eUTPzwFb33X5917JNXaxu
transaction
687191a90bbce494e3102cc17a7209615989b84c748a22efeb9090690e4cc4f5
spent
true